Output ecf9e1ae5574034378d91391d49d32c54e309e990491a393a858e965cfa54be9:186

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253d95b38351e0a45dad001fec64cd61d52a3f0a OP_EQUAL
address
D8Y1KLjUKx9pbXDE7JAiFstQg3RiWhZK8d
transaction
ecf9e1ae5574034378d91391d49d32c54e309e990491a393a858e965cfa54be9
spent
true